Introduction
LG Electronics India is positioning itself for a period of significant growth, with the company’s strategic roadmap for the 2027 fiscal year heavily centered on the premium consumer electronics segment. By focusing on larger television displays and high-end refrigeration units, the firm aims to capture a greater share of the evolving Indian market.
The company’s outlook for FY27 reflects a broader shift in consumer behavior, where buyers are increasingly gravitating toward big-ticket items that offer advanced technology and superior build quality. As LG India scales its operations, these specific product categories are expected to serve as the primary engines driving its financial performance and market influence.
What Happened
LG India has identified a clear trajectory for its fiscal year 2027, prioritizing the expansion of its footprint in the premium home appliance and entertainment sectors. The company is doubling down on its inventory of large-screen televisions and top-tier refrigerators, responding to a notable uptick in consumer demand for high-specification home electronics.
This strategic pivot is designed to leverage the company’s existing manufacturing and distribution capabilities to meet the needs of a growing demographic of premium buyers. By emphasizing high-value products, LG intends to strengthen its competitive positioning against other global players operating within the Indian subcontinent.
